Q: Is 51,543,216 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 51,543,216 is a composite number.

Why is 51,543,216 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 51,543,216 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 18 24 27 36 48 54 72 81 108 144 162 216 243 324 432 486 491 648 729 972 982 1,296 1,458 1,473 1,944 1,964 2,187 2,916 2,946 3,888 3,928 4,374 4,419 5,832 5,892 6,561 7,856 8,748 8,838 11,664 11,784 13,122 13,257 17,496 17,676 23,568 26,244 26,514 34,992 35,352 39,771 52,488 53,028 70,704 79,542 104,976 106,056 119,313 159,084 212,112 238,626 318,168 357,939 477,252 636,336 715,878 954,504 1,073,817 1,431,756 1,909,008 2,147,634 2,863,512 3,221,451 4,295,268 5,727,024 6,442,902 8,590,536 12,885,804 17,181,072 25,771,608 and 51,543,216, with no remainder.

Since 51,543,216 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,543,216, it is a composite number.
